General Motors - Bismarck, ND

posted 2 months ago

Full-time - Mid Level
Remote - Bismarck, ND
Transportation Equipment Manufacturing

About the position

The Marketing Applied Sciences team at General Motors is dedicated to developing analytics-driven solutions that empower various GM organizations to achieve their business objectives. As a Data Engineer, you will be an integral part of a multi-disciplinary team, collaborating with professionals of varying experience levels to design, develop, and deploy analytic models that support business-facing analytic groups. This role emphasizes both advanced analytics strategy and applied, project-based solutions, focusing on the company's most critical business areas. You will be responsible for building analytical data sets that support Advanced Analytics projects, working closely with innovative Researchers and Data Scientists to deliver value aligned with GM's vision for the future. This position reports to the Product Owner of Marketing Activation Science and has visibility within the broader Enterprise Data, Analytics, and Insights organization, which is focused on democratizing data and decision-making across the company. In this role, you will collaborate with internal and external stakeholders, including Activation Data Science, to deliver on the portfolio of projects. You will drive the adoption of cloud-first technologies and industry-standard Data Engineering practices, which are essential for accelerating and scaling GM's engineering capabilities. Adhering to established standards and processes, you will validate, monitor, and support data products that enable the decision science portfolio and enhance data science capabilities. Your collaboration will extend to cross-functional teams, including data governance, security, data architecture, release management, Dev & ML Ops, and infrastructure, ensuring seamless integration and alignment of data engineering initiatives. Staying abreast of emerging trends and technologies in Data Engineering will be crucial, as you will proactively identify opportunities for improvement and innovation within the organization. Additionally, you will participate in fostering a culture of continuous learning, knowledge sharing, and development within the team and the broader data engineering community.

Responsibilities

  • Collaborate with internal and external stakeholders, including Activation Data Science to deliver on the portfolio.
  • Drive the adoption of cloud-first technologies and industry-standard Data Engineering practices to accelerate and scale engineering capabilities.
  • Adhere to standards and processes to validate, monitor, and support data products that enable the decision science portfolio and data science capabilities.
  • Collaborate with cross-functional teams, including data governance, security, data architecture, release management, Dev & ML Ops, and infrastructure, to ensure seamless integration and alignment of data engineering initiatives.
  • Stay up to date with emerging trends and technologies in the field of Data Engineering, and proactively identify opportunities for improvement and innovation within the organization.
  • Participate in a culture of continuous learning, knowledge sharing, and development within the team and the broader data engineering community.

Requirements

  • 7+ years of hands-on experience developing and implementing enterprise-scale data and analytics solutions using modern hybrid cloud technologies with a focus on data pipelines and reporting.
  • Bachelor's degree (or equivalent work experience) in Computer Science, Data Science, Software Engineering, or a related field. Master's degree is a plus.
  • Strong problem-solving and analytical skills with practical experience analyzing and curating large scale customer event data products from disparate data sources including 1st party and 3rd party data and map type data with variable structure.
  • In-depth knowledge of industry-standard Data Engineering practices including data privacy & security, ETL/ELT, data architecture, data quality assurance, performance optimization, source code management, release management, and operations.
  • Expert programming skills in data and analytics platforms, big data processing frameworks and languages, and development tools including Azure (or similar), Databricks, Spark, Python, SQL, and GitHub.
  • Effective communication and people skills, with the ability to collaborate effectively with cross-functional technical teams and non-technical stakeholders.
  • Naturally curious with the ability to work independently and proactively.
  • Experience working in an Agile development environment.
  • Experience deploying machine learning models and process automation.

Nice-to-haves

  • Master's degree in a related field.

Benefits

  • Medical, dental, and vision insurance options.
  • Health Savings Account and Flexible Spending Accounts.
  • Retirement savings plan with company and matching contributions.
  • Sickness and accident benefits.
  • Life insurance coverage.
  • Paid vacation and holidays.
  • Tuition assistance programs.
  • Employee assistance program.
  • GM vehicle discounts.
  • Global recognition program for peers and leaders.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service